WWE is set to return to Japan for a house show tour next week, starting in Osaka on July 25th and continuing at Ryōgoku Sumo Hall on July 26th and 27th.
The tour will feature top WWE stars, including Undisputed WWE Champion Cody Rhodes, Bianca Belair, Shinsuke Nakamura, Dakota Kai, Asuka, and Kairi Sane. However, Asuka is currently sidelined with a knee injury, so she will most likely have a non-wrestling role.
It should be noted that Meiko Satomura is also advertised to work this tour.
Meiko Satomura, who co-founded Sendai Girls’ Pro Wrestling and has been with WWE since 2020, will return to in-ring action after not wrestling since March 7, 2023. She will team up with Jade Cargill and Bianca Belair to face Damage CTRL (IYO SKY, Kairi Sane, and Dakota Kai).
Satomura is a former NXT UK Women’s Champion and also wrestled in WCW back in 1996 & 1997.
Below are the advertised matches for next week’s Live Events in Japan:
July 25
– Undisputed WWE Championship Match: Cody Rhodes (c) vs. Shinsuke Nakamura vs. AJ Styles
– World Heavyweight Championship Match: Damian Priest (c) vs. Jey Uso
– Bianca Belair, Jade Cargill & Meiko Satomura vs. Damage CTRL (IYO SKY, Kairi Sane & Dakota Kai)
July 26
– Undisputed WWE Championship Match: Cody Rhodes (c) vs. AJ Styles
– World Heavyweight Championship Match: Damian Priest (c) vs. Jey Uso
– Bianca Belair, Jade Cargill & Meiko Satomura vs. Damage CTRL (IYO SKY, Kairi Sane & Dakota Kai)
– Shinsuke Nakamura vs. LA Knight
July 27
– Undisputed WWE Championship Match: Cody Rhodes (c) vs. LA Knight vs. Shinsuke Nakamura vs. AJ Styles
– World Heavyweight Championship Match: Damian Priest (c) vs. Rey Mysterio
– Bianca Belair, Jade Cargill & Meiko Satomura vs. Damage CTRL (IYO SKY, Kairi Sane & Dakota Kai)
